GOP presidential hopeful Herman Cain told CNN last night that homosexuality is a choice and his stance against abortion should not be a “directive” to the nation.
The comments by Cain, who is essentially tied with Mitt Romney at the top of recent national polls for the GOP nod, could get further scrutiny in early states such as Iowa and South Carolina where social conservatives play a key role in picking a nominee.
“Although people don’t agree with me, I happen to think that it is a personal choice,” Cain said about homosexuality in the Wednesday night interview.
When CNN host Piers Morgan said he believed Cain’s comments were akin to a gay person telling the candidate that he chose to be black, Cain responded: “You know that’s not true. I was born black,” adding his race “doesn’t wash off.”
